Helmy Kresa

Profile:

German-American songwriter and arranger (born November 7, 1904 in Meissen, – died August 19, 1991 at Southampton Hospital on Long Island, New York, USA)

Kresa began working as the musical secretary, principal arranger, and orchestrator for Irving Berlin, who could not read or write music, in 1926. Eventually, he served as the general professional manager of the Irving Berlin Music Company.

Kresa's arrangement of "All of Me" (written by Seymour Simons) was the first one published.
